The "Driver" Problem

Here lies the crux of the issue. The Actia XS Evolution was designed for an era when Windows XP and Windows 7 were kings. The drivers—the software files that tell the computer how to talk to the cable—were written for those operating systems.

As Microsoft forced updates to Windows 8, 8.1, and 10, the Actia drivers began to fail. Official support for these legacy tools has waned, leaving mechanics with expensive bricks. Plug the device into a USB port on a Windows 10 laptop, and you’re often met with the dreaded "Device not recognized" error.

Advanced Configuration: Power Management & Latency

To achieve dealer-level speed with the verified repack, tweak these hidden settings:

  1. Disable USB Selective Suspend:

    • Control Panel > Power Options > Change Plan Settings > Change Advanced Settings > USB Settings > USB selective suspend setting > Disabled.
  2. Latency Timer (Critical):

    • In Device Manager, right-click the Actia COM port > Properties > Advanced.
    • Change Latency Timer from 16 ms to 1 ms.
    • This prevents timeout errors during long programming sessions (BSI updates).
  3. Driver Buffer Size:

    • Set both "Receive Buffer" and "Transmit Buffer" to Low (1) or Medium (1) . High buffers cause overflow on multiplexed ECUs.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Does this verified repack work on MacOS or Linux? A: No. The repack is exclusively for Windows. For Linux, you would manually compile libftdi with PSA patches—not recommended.

Q: My Actia is a "EuroGrab" clone. Will the repack work? A: Most likely yes. The verified repack is designed for generic FT245R chips. However, genuine Actia PCBs have a capacitor on pin 13; cheap clones don't, which can cause random disconnections. The repack cannot fix hardware flaws.

Q: Can I use this repack for other brands (Ford, BMW, VAG)? A: No. The "PSA XS Evolution" drivers are tuned for the PSA protocol stack (DiagBox, PP2000, Lexia). For Ford, you'd need a J2534-2 compliant driver set.

Q: After installing the repack, my other FTDI devices (Arduino, USB-RS232) stopped working. A: Yes, this is a known side effect. The repack replaces the system-wide FTDI driver. To fix, uninstall the Actia driver and let Windows reinstall the generic FTDI driver when you plug in your Arduino. Use a separate laptop for Actia work.
